Oneliner

Demonstrate the first quantum key exchange between a CubeSat and ground.

Description

In QUBEII, further developments are now performed subsequently to fully integrate all functional elements to build and launch a CubeSat, able to perform quantum key distribution. The demonstration of secure quantum key distribution between the QUBE-II satellite and a ground station on earth is expected to lay the foundation for global, secure communications with in particular, low resource requirements
